HEIMO ZOBERNIG AT MUDAM

Heimo Zobernig’s new exhibition takes place at Mudam in Luxembourg until September 7.  Zobernig’s exhibition unfolds in two chapters. After Luxembourg, it will be continued at the Kestnergesellschaft in Hanover in November, where it will also occupy two distinct spaces. The first gallery will host the same group of sculptures, while the second will present a different series of paintings based on the most recent work shown in the exhibition at Mudam, Untitled (2013).
